Need Bike Safety? UCLA and Sustainable Streets Host Free Event

With electric scooters dominating headlines, what better way to avoid them completely than jumping on a bike!

Representatives from Sustainable Streets will educate the community about best practices for cyclists riding on the streets including information on right-of-way rules, safety equipment, avoiding common injuries, route planning and local resources.

The free event is on Wed. Aug. 1 from 6- 7:30 pm at UCLA Medical Center, Santa Monica, 1250 16th Street.  Conference Room 3.  RSVP (800) 516-5323
